How does your media product
represent particular social
groups?
Evaluation – Question 2
The social groups that are represented in my are British
and American young adults which is in coordination with
my target audience as it allows the reader to be able to
connect & relate more with the magazine. All images of
models in my magazine are males as this follows typical
conventions of my magazine genre however I did want to
use a female model as well to help with the gender
imbalance. Despite this the magazine is still targeted at
males and females equally and I tried to overcome the
lack of female images by tailoring the model’s pose in
order to be less intimidating and go against hegemonic
norms to be equally as appealing to the female audience.
Mise En Scene
The general idea was to dress the model appropriately and
relative to my target audience. The front cover features a
model wearing typical attire for the genre of my magazine –
leather jacket, gold chains, dark tee – this gives an instant
impression and allows readers to tell the genre through visual
recognition. The gold chains were further used on the contents
page and dark jeans and a white tee also followed the genre’s
conventions along with a gold watch to give a more affluent look
to the model and something that a young, impressionable adult
would want to aspire to. The double page spread was designed
to show the individual nature of the artist which was further
highlighted by wearing a hat to reduce chances of eye contact
even more. The general clothing again relates to the target
audience – jeans, tee and a hoodie allowing the reader to relate
without using means such as direct mode of address.
Shot Types
Two of my three shots of a model were eye line shots with the
model looking directly down the camera lens in order to create
direct mode of address and allow the reader to make a connection
with the model (uses and grat.) Furthermore the facial
expressions used aren’t the typical intimidating or challenging
types, instead they are much softer which will allow the female
audience to create a better connection with the magazine. The
double page spread image is again purposefully challenging typical
conventions in order to create the desired atmosphere for that
particular image. The use of a long shot captures the artist and
the background and shows the importance of the subject which
enables the idea of independence and individuality to be created.
Layout
The layout of the magazine is designed specifically to be
representative of young adults through the simplicity of the
text and the use of colour and bold letters. All text is designed to
be easily read and allow readers to be able to follow words
across a line as well as capture all information from top to
bottom. All features are also current and feature big names to
keep attention from the audience and there isn’t excessive
amounts of text which would be more commonly found in
magazines aimed at older generations.
Ideology
In my production I prioritised the reception theory with the ability to relate the audience and their
age to the featured artists in the magazine. This creates a personal relationship between reader
and artist which entices the reader and can create a big fan base through the relation between
reader and magazine. This was achieved by shot positioning such as direct mode of address and
confident posing which creates an image that my target audience would aspire to. Furthermore the
informality of the text similar to that of VIBE and XXL which can grab the audience through relation
in the text and increases the likelihood of them receiving the intended message and keeping
attention.
